GitHub ELGamal密碼 ELGamal密碼是除了RSA之外最有代表性的公開密鑰密碼之一,它的安全性建立在離散對數問題的困難性之上,是一種公認安全的公鑰密碼。 離散對數問題 設p為素數,若存在一個正整數α,使得α、α2、...、αp-1關於模p互不同余,則稱α為模p ...
GitHub 橢圓曲線密碼 橢圓曲線密碼 Elliptic Curve Cryptosystem ,簡稱ECC,是Neal Koblitz和Victor Miller於 年提出的。 研究發現,有限域上的橢圓曲線上的一些點構成交換群,而且離散對數問題是難解的。於是在此群上定義ELGamal密碼,並稱為橢圓曲線密碼。 目前,橢圓曲線密碼已成為除RSA密碼之外呼聲最高的公鑰密碼之一。它密鑰短 簽名短 軟 ...
2019-01-26 22:46 0 1537 推薦指數:
GitHub ELGamal密碼 ELGamal密碼是除了RSA之外最有代表性的公開密鑰密碼之一,它的安全性建立在離散對數問題的困難性之上,是一種公認安全的公鑰密碼。 離散對數問題 設p為素數,若存在一個正整數α,使得α、α2、...、αp-1關於模p互不同余,則稱α為模p ...
=1\), 則可以得到平面上的橢圓曲線\(Ep(x,y)\)。 對平面上橢圓曲線上的點P, Q, R,以及 ...
原文鏈接:Elliptic Curve Cryptography: ECDH and ECDSA 這篇文章是ECC系列的第三篇。 在之前的文章中,我們已經知道了橢圓曲線是什么,並且為了對橢圓曲線上的點做一些數學運算我們定義了群公理。然后我們將橢圓曲線限制在整數取模的有限域上。在該條 ...
一、橢圓曲線的基本概念 簡單的說橢圓曲線並不是橢圓,之所以稱為橢圓曲線是因為他們是用三次方程來表示,並且該方程與計算橢圓周長的方程相似。 對密碼學比較有意義的是基於素數域GF(p)和基於二進制域(GF(2^m))上的橢圓曲線。 下面重點介紹基於GF(p)上的橢圓曲線 ...
帶寬占用較少。目前我國居民二代身份證正在使用 256 位的橢圓曲線密碼,虛擬貨幣比特幣也選擇ECC作為加 ...
1、基本概念 1)橢圓曲線方程的一般形式:y^2 = x^3 + a*x + b,其中要求滿足不等式 4*a^3 + 27*b^2 ≠ 0 例如:y^2 = x^3 + x + 1 mod 23 2)橢圓曲線上的點的加法公式(適用於 P ≠ Q 的情況):設 P = (x1, y1),Q ...
一、概述 橢圓曲線加密算法依賴於橢圓曲線理論,后者理論涵蓋的知識比較深廣,而且涉及數論中比較深奧的問題。經過數學家幾百年的研究積累,已經有很多重要的成果,一些很棘手的數學難題依賴橢圓曲線理論得以解決(比如費馬大定理)。 本文涉及的橢圓曲線知識只是抽取與密碼學相關的很小的一個角落,涉及到很淺 ...
今天在學橢圓曲線密碼(Elliptic Curve Cryptography,ECC)算法,自己手里缺少介紹該算法的專業書籍,故在網上查了很多博文與書籍,但是大多數博客寫的真的是。。。你懂的。。。真不愧是 ‘天下文章一大抄’ 啊! 雷同不說,關鍵是介紹的都不是很清楚,是我在閱讀過程中、產生 ...